Output 261b1faf7f5c90a64d3df48e4aa6a920b55bf75a99d0ff9d611889fad89e4546:410

value
300454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 789601aee5ab44c903eff0886bccb04d4c3d4dde OP_EQUAL
address
2N4Epmwf24B2Cdd15hYaBR7busrUYYb1axa
transaction
261b1faf7f5c90a64d3df48e4aa6a920b55bf75a99d0ff9d611889fad89e4546
confirmations
507
spent
true